The G8 ink. Words, voices, stories about Genoa.

Genoa, July 2001. 300.000 people were on the streets against the G8. For three days the capital of Liguria was scene for a collective dream: an other world is possible, the slogan that puts together even very different individual paths. The murder of Carlo Giuliani and the violences in the police stations, in the hospitals and on the streets stages the other side of Genoa: a collective nightmare - which is difficult to get over.

Three years later, Indymedia Italy, network for independent communication launches a project to collect signs, traces and memory of the G8 in Genoa. A space to recover and to enhance what was produced during and after July 2001. An excuse to tell what we saw, thought and felt.

Literature and art from a pen, a keyboard, a felt tip.
Radio and newspapers, web-sites and videos, songs and comic strips. Diaries and stories, novels and freaks. Stories from direct experiences. Pieces of life and movement. Personal images. Fragments of memory from the dream or from the nightmare of the G8 in Genoa.

Memory is a collective gear. Let it work!

The multimedia stuff, that will be collected through the "G8-ink" project will be published and enhanced as documentary stuff ans artistic and political evidence.

.: .: Indymedia takes part in the SupportoG8 project:.
SupportoG8 is a network of people who follow the trials of Genoa-G8: trials against people who were there to demonstrare, trials against public officiers, accused of violence, tortures, power abuse. SupportoG8 transcribes the hearings, makes summaries of them, publishes and spread transcriptions and reports. SupportoG8 proposes projects, campaigns and initiatives for information and fund raising. SupportoG8 supports the Genoa Legal Forum - the lawyers that defend the accused people or represent the plaintiffs in the trials - and contributes to the analysis and the recording of audio, video and written materials that testify the history of the days of Genoa. For the trials and for the collective memory.
